Does carbamazepine-induced reduction of plasma haloperidol levels worsen psychotic symptoms?

0

Seven psychotic patients’ plasma haloperidol levels, determined with gas-liquid chromatography, fell a mean of 60% when carbamazepine treatment was instituted. Two patients’ levels became undetectable, and their symptoms worsened. Haloperidol level monitoring may be required for patients given both haloperidol and carbamazepine.
